Keep Those Baby Teeth Healthy: Essential Pediatric Dentistry
Protecting your child’s dental health starts early. First teeth are important because they help children chew properly, speak clearly, and reserve room for their permanent teeth to come in. Regular visits to a pediatric dentist are crucial for ensuring those primary teeth stay healthy. During these appointments, the dentist will assess your child’s mouth for any cavities, and provide advice on proper oral hygiene practices.
Teaching your child good dental habits at a young age can set them up for a lifetime of healthy teeth. Make sure they brush twice a more info day with fluoride toothpaste, and schedule regular dental checkups.
Protecting Tiny Grins: A Guide to Children's Oral Health
A shining smile is a wonderful feature to watch. Children's oral health plays a vital role in their overall well-being. Starting with a young age, it's essential to create good dental practices.
Frequent visits to the dentist are key for spotting problems before they arise. During these appointments, your child's teeth will be checked for holes, and the dentist can provide tips on proper tooth cleaning.
Instructing children about good oral health starts at home. Make sure your child cleans their teeth twice a day for two minutes using a fluoride dental paste. Don't miss to clean between teeth daily as well.
A balanced diet that is low in sugar can also help in reducing the likelihood of tooth decay. Limit your child's intake of sugary drinks and offer them plenty of vegetables.
Laying a Strong Foundation: Early Dental Checkups for Kids
A beautiful smile starts young! Taking your child to the dentist for their first checkup by their third birthday is crucial for establishing good oral hygiene habits and preventing potential dental problems down the road. These early visits allow the dentist to inspect your child's teeth and gums, discuss proper brushing and flossing techniques, and answer any questions you may have about your child's oral health.
Keep in mind that making dental visits a positive experience for your child is essential. Be sure to:
* Choose a dentist who specializes in youth dentistry and has a welcoming atmosphere.
* Read books or tell stories about going to the dentist to help your child feel at ease.
* Make the visit fun by letting your child select their favorite toothbrush and toothpaste.
